📣 Hinweise für Reisende
Portugal boasts a rich cultural history with many attractive destinations, including historical sites, beaches, and gourmet experiences. Visitors can enjoy diverse activities ranging from surfing (e.g., Nazaré) and golf to religious pilgrimages (e.g., Fátima) and skiing (Serra da Estrela).
- Traditional music and fairs are common, particularly in Northern Portugal and after summer.
- Summer events include regional parades and music festivals (e.g., Paredes de Coura).
- Villages and cities often host religious or harvest festivals with traditional clothing, floats, and fireworks.
- Regional fairs showcase local produce, crafts, and arts.
- For a full list of major annual events, consult the official tourism website.
- The 'Carnaval' is a major holiday, but many smaller, regional festivals occur throughout the year.
- When visiting religious sites, dress respectfully and maintain silence. Smoking is prohibited in most indoor public spaces but allowed in designated outdoor areas. While bullfighting is a traditional event, its support is not universally accepted.
